Output 68850abdff5e461abb473aff1799480611328e47318be790858140acd8198660:0

value
4000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de2f7280659bb95a4ee6241f8eba6b3267f7d8c OP_EQUAL
address
MAdBiq4jFwKvqtVCAzwexszVg4avA5EG4T
transaction
68850abdff5e461abb473aff1799480611328e47318be790858140acd8198660
spent
true